This is the last photograph of the Saint, taken exactly one
month before her death. She is arranged in the cloister walk on
a long reclining chair. Therese is wearing a simple night veil
on her head, and over that a cap of white wool. The two straps
of the small night scapular can be seen around her neck. Illness
has made her face almost unrecognizable.
